Share via


ID3D11TracingDevice::SetShaderTrackingOptions メソッド (d3d11sdklayers.h)

特定のシェーダーの参照ラスタライザーの競合状態追跡オプションを設定します。

構文

HRESULT SetShaderTrackingOptions(
  [in] IUnknown *pShader,
  [in] UINT     Options
);

パラメーター

[in] pShader

シェーダーの IUnknown インターフェイスへのポインター。

[in] Options

ビットごとの OR 演算を使用して結合されるD3D11_SHADER_TRACKING_OPTIONS型指定フラグの組み合わせ。 結果の値は、追跡オプションを識別します。 フラグが存在する場合、フラグが表す追跡オプションは "on" に設定されます。それ以外の場合、追跡オプションは "off" に設定されます。

戻り値

このメソッドは、 Direct3D 11 のリターン コードのいずれかを返します

注釈

D3D11_SHADER_TRACKING_OPTION_UAV_SPECIFIC_FLAGS)コンピューティング シェーダーの Options パラメーターでは、 SetShaderTrackingOptions によって無視されます。

 
メモこの API には、Windows 8用の Windows ソフトウェア開発キット (SDK) が必要です。
 

要件

要件
サポートされている最小のクライアント Windows 8 [デスクトップ アプリ |UWP アプリ]
サポートされている最小のサーバー Windows Server 2012 [デスクトップ アプリ |UWP アプリ]
対象プラットフォーム Windows
ヘッダー d3d11sdklayers.h
Library D3DCompiler.lib

こちらもご覧ください

ID3D11TracingDevice